Dashboards & Visualizations

how to add a drop down to pick what csv lookup to use in a dashboard

sbattista
Explorer

is there a way to add a drop down option to a dashboard that can change what csv lookup it uses? 

 

 

 

Tags (2)
0 Karma

sbattista
Explorer

thank you this will work for now, is there a way to make it less manual? can it auto populate the list of csv's based in a app context? 

0 Karma

kamlesh_vaghela
SplunkTrust
SplunkTrust

@sbattista 

I have updated my answer. Please check it.

KV

0 Karma

kamlesh_vaghela
SplunkTrust
SplunkTrust

@sbattista 

Try this sample XML. Here, I have created a.csv, b.csv and c.csv with sample data.

 

 

<form>
  <label>Dynamic Lookup</label>
  <fieldset submitButton="false">
    <input type="dropdown" token="tkn_csv_file">
      <label>Select File</label>
      <fieldForLabel>title</fieldForLabel>
      <fieldForValue>title</fieldForValue>
      <search>
        <query>| rest /servicesNS/-/-/data/lookup-table-files | where 'eai:acl.app'="$env:app$" | table title</query>
        <earliest>-24h@h</earliest>
        <latest>now</latest>
      </search>
    </input>
  </fieldset>
  <row>
    <panel>
      <table>
        <search>
          <query>| inputlookup $tkn_csv_file$</query>
          <earliest>-24h@h</earliest>
          <latest>now</latest>
        </search>
        <option name="drilldown">none</option>
      </table>
    </panel>
  </row>
</form>

 

 

Thanks
KV
▄︻̷̿┻̿═━一

If any of my reply helps you to solve the problem Or gain knowledge, an upvote would be appreciated.

Get Updates on the Splunk Community!

Data Management Digest – December 2025

Welcome to the December edition of Data Management Digest! As we continue our journey of data innovation, the ...

Index This | What is broken 80% of the time by February?

December 2025 Edition   Hayyy Splunk Education Enthusiasts and the Eternally Curious!    We’re back with this ...

Unlock Faster Time-to-Value on Edge and Ingest Processor with New SPL2 Pipeline ...

Hello Splunk Community,   We're thrilled to share an exciting update that will help you manage your data more ...